When Did AI Start Changing Patient Care?

The journey from promise to practice hasn’t happened overnight. Since the early 2000s, AI in medical fields started with simple computer-aided detection systems. Fast forward to 2022, and we counted over 22000 advanced AI solutions actively deployed in AI medical imaging alone.

Take the case of a hospital in Germany that integrated AI to analyze lung CT scans during the Covid-19 pandemic. In just three months, the AI system helped reduce diagnostic times by 70%, enabling quicker isolation and treatment of infected patients. It’s like turning a paper map into GPS — navigating complexity became both faster and clearer.

Common Myths About AI in Healthcare: What’s True and What Isn’t?

Here’s where we clear up some common misconceptions:

Myth Reality
AI will replace doctors AI enhances doctors’ abilities but doesn’t replace human judgment.
AI can make 100% accurate diagnosis No system is flawless; AI reduces errors but cant guarantee perfection.
AI diagnostics tools are only for large hospitals Increasingly affordable AI solutions are available for clinics and small practices.
Patients lose privacy with AI Strict regulations (like GDPR) ensure data is handled securely.
Using AI is too complicated for doctors Training programs and intuitive interfaces are making AI easier to use every year.
AI recommendations override doctor’s decisions Doctors always have the final say; AI supports, not dictates, clinical decisions.
Implementing AI is prohibitively expensive Cost-benefit analyses show long-term savings and better patient outcomes.
AI only supports imaging diagnostics AI applies to lab tests, patient monitoring, and predictive analytics beyond imaging.
AI results are hard to interpret Visualizations and explanations built into systems improve transparency.
AI cant help in rare diseases AI models trained on vast datasets increasingly recognize rare patterns.

Future Research and the Next Frontier in AI Patient Care

Looking ahead, research is focused on combining AI with genomics and wearable tech, enabling continuous, personalized monitoring. Experimental models show potential to predict disease onset years before symptoms appear — a game-changer for preventive care.

One bold study analyzed over 22000 patient records and found AI could forecast heart attacks with 85% accuracy, far exceeding traditional risk calculators. It’s like having a health crystal ball, empowering timely interventions and saving lives.
